Output 747a8463dac00533878f3015bf14cdb8e16a9f0ca0f74a56e85b6e0df602be6a:0

value
24798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c521cbbcc508b7ce594ab85f66c68273a1a80b98 OP_EQUAL
address
3KfMXWbde7GLQGZ6XyZEzGEtwMeSqiBvLv
transaction
747a8463dac00533878f3015bf14cdb8e16a9f0ca0f74a56e85b6e0df602be6a
confirmations
181850
spent
true